5 Symptoms Women Often Think Are “Normal Aging” — But Aren’t Many women are told that certain symptoms are simply part of getting older. While our bodies do change over time, persistent symptoms are often signals that something deeper may need attention. Here are 5 symptoms I frequently see in clinic that women are told are “normal aging,” but often have underlying causes: ✨ Constant fatigue Feeling tired all the time isn’t something you just have to accept. Hormones, iron levels, thyroid health, and nutrient deficiencies can all play a role. ✨ Brain fog or difficulty concentrating Many women notice changes in memory or focus during their late 30s and 40s. Hormonal shifts, sleep disruption, and stress can all contribute. ✨ Weight gain around the midsection Changes in metabolism and hormone balance can influence how the body stores fat, particularly during perimenopause. ✨ Poor sleep Trouble falling asleep or waking during the night is often linked to shifts in progesterone, cortisol patterns, or blood sugar balance. ✨ Mood changes or increased anxiety Hormones have a powerful impact on the nervous system. Feeling more anxious, irritable, or emotionally sensitive can sometimes reflect underlying hormonal changes. These symptoms are common, but they are not something you simply have to live with.
